Manchester United and Major League Soccer announced Thursday that the storied English club will embark on another tour of the US this summer. But the 2010 edition will be unlike any other. مانشستر يونايتد و نجوم امريكاFor the first time in club history, the Red Devils will take on MLS opposition, highlighted by their taking on MLS’ best in the 2010 AT&T MLS All-Star Game on July 28 at Reliant Stadium in Houston (8:30 pm ET on ESPN2 and TeleFutura). Before the MLS All-Stars take their crack at the 18-time English champions, the expansion Philadelphia Union (July 21 at time TBD) and the Kansas City Wizards (July 25 at 6 pm ET) will get their shot. “Manchester United are among the most recognized and successful clubs in the world, and we are pleased to have them compete against our All-Stars and two MLS clubs this summer,” MLS Commissioner Don Garber said. “We are proud to once again present our supporters with one of the most compelling All-Star game formats in sports and we believe Manchester United’s North American tour will be a tremendous celebration of the sport following the 2010 World Cup in South Africa.” In the lead-up to the MLS friendlies, ManU’s North American travels will see them take on Scottish giants Celtic at the Rogers Centre in Toronto on July 16. “It’s great to be going back to North America,” Manchester United manager Sir Alex Ferguson said. “I enjoyed the last two tours there in 2003 and 2004 immensely.
